Mersa in Summer
In summer (June, July and August), Mersa sees average daytime highs around 30°C and overnight lows near 18°C, with 101 mm of rain over about 19 wet days across the season. It is the warmest season of the year and the 3rd-wettest season.
Over the season highs ease from about 31°C in early June to 29°C by late August.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 51% of the time across summer, and the air most often feels dry.

Where is Mersa?
Mersa sits at 11.7°N, 39.6°E, 1,721 m above sea level, in Ethiopia. The nearest listed city is Weldiya, 19 km away.
Topography around Mersa
How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 3, 16 and 80 km of Mersa.
Within 3 km, the terrain around Mersa has signific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 451 m around an average of 1,673 m above sea level; within 16 km, very signific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 2,229 m; within 80 km, extreme vari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 3,515 m.
The land around Mersa is covered by cropland (48%) and shrubs (33%) within 3 km, shrubs (41%) and cropland (37%) within 16 km, and shrubs (36%), cropland (29%) and grassland (28%) within 80 km.
